Job Details
This is an exciting role working directly with Unilever by driving sales with buyers and availability in depots across major C&C accounts, in this role you will also be responsible for central ordering and finances.
Role:
- To complete three-weekly central orders for the entire Dhamecha C&C group, advising on special promotions, current stock values, local promotions and new products as needed.
- Meeting buyers and driving sales as dictated by the needs of the Unilever business throughout both Landmark, Today's and Independent buying groups in depot and at C&C Head Office's
- Working with Unilever's internal sales teams, the CDE and Senior TM, Cash & Carry head offices and depot managers to drive stock into the depots.
- Drive on shelf availability of products by adjusting book stocks, ordering to delivery schedules and claiming space by negotiation with depots.
- Influence incremental product/POS display - Negotiate increased visibility of key focus areas and utilise additional display units and brand POS to maximise product visibility and drive sales.
- Instigating and landing local promotions in addition to national promotions with the CDE and CAM.
- New Product Distribution - Delivery of promotional presentations to buyers in order to gain listings and maximise distribution and visibility of new product launches across your territory.
- Joint Business Plans - Accurate recording of current depot activity and the identification of future opportunities to increase sales and work with depots on local strengths to maximise opportunities. Completion of depot reports for feedback to buyers.
- Manage and attend in-depot and external roadshows to maximise sales and encourage footfall and growth.
- To analyse depot sales data and working with Unilever's CDE / CAM team and depot managers to understand trends and opportunities in depots.
Other responsibilities include:
- Building and maintaining relationships with contacts at all levels across the depots
- Liaise with the CDE and CAM to develop local promotions
- Develop high levels of insight/knowledge of Unilever and in-depot expertise
- Utilise selling and closing skills to deliver business objectives.
- Taking ownership for their own KPI's and strives to exceed them.
- Delivers work on time and to appropriate quality.
- Demonstrates a passion to understand Unilever's organisation, product and business environment.
Skills Required:
- Confidence in analysing spreadsheet data and creating own spreadsheets to use in-call, using all MS Office programs in presentations, emails and letters.
- Strong numerical skills and an understanding of VAT / GP% / NIV
- Excellent communication skills, both verbal and written.
- Persistent and resilient, willing to overcome objections and take a pragmatic approach to setbacks and challenges.
- Able to demonstrate the ability to develop long-term relationships.
- Proactive - each depot is a self-contained business whilst remaining part of a group - there are opportunities for salesmanship and landing KPI's in every site but the candidate needs to seek them out consistently and with purpose.
